Sesame Chili and Parsley Crusted Lamb Fillets

This is another really quick recipe to make with the end resulting in a lovely tender lamb fillet. I cooked this in a frying pan but this could also be cooked on the BBQ. I do not like my lamb overcooked and like it pink in the centre. I cook mine about 5-8 Min's a side depending on the thickness. I then cover it and let it stand for a further 5 Min's, this additional standing time cooks the lamb just the way I like, but cook as you prefer. Directions

  1. Combine sesame seeds, chili flakes and parsley in a bowl.
  2. Combine lamb fillets in a large bowl with the oil.
  3. Place lamb one at a time in sesame seed mixture and coat each fillet all over.
  4. Cook either on a lightly oiled grill plate, fry pan, or on the BBQ until browned on both sides and cooked as desired. Cover and stand 5 Min's then slice thickly.
  5. I served mine over fruity saffron rice, but it also goes well with a crisp green salad topped with tomatoes and bocconcini.
